Transaction 86397597539bda4ca100141e67707b7046bf42f482f1a47e9aaa3b4bc7d21c64
1 Input
1 Output
-
86397597539bda4ca100141e67707b7046bf42f482f1a47e9aaa3b4bc7d21c64:0
- value
- 1415956
- script pubkey
- OP_0 OP_PUSHBYTES_20 11dcd329e7b12e17317eafc3b0670f015806dba6
- address
- bc1qz8wdx208kyhpwvt74lpmqec0q9vqdkaxjzv95j